No app support

I had read the SPECTATOR for years in print and was thrilled to have the ease of the APP. I love the writing. HOWEVER, subscribing thru iTunes (which is the only way you can do a monthly sub) has become a nightmare in using the app. For many months the app is not recognizing the iTunes sub on any iOS device. Mini iPad, iPad or iPhone. I have submitted several ticket and no one responds with a viable solution. There is no web id for iTunes users and no matter how many times I delete and reinstall the app there are NO DOWNLOADS of the current mags. Nor can one use the iTunes sub to access the website ... This is really unforgivable - the app has not been updated since 2014 and there was a major iOS update this year. Its sad. I doubt I will hear from any one at the SPECTATOR. If I do I will come back and write another review. Do not purchase this app.

The Cream of Contemporary British Commentary

Slightly to the left of the WSJ and much more to the right of the NY Times, the Spectator combines the very best of British commentary on world politics and the arts. The contributions of the weekly columnists are erudite and constantly entertaining. Overall, the best weekly read for anyone with the most marginal interest in UK culture but beyond this a fine-edged view of word events.
